End of May 🪻

We can breathe a sigh of relief now the first show of 2026 is done and dusted!

Leading up to a show we do a lot of intensive training, walking and washing them every day, to create strong bonds with our animals and forge habits in their behaviour.

We had a successful day at Shropshire County show - our teams behaved impeccably 👌

Mr Whitepeak came home with Blonde breed Champion and my Sycamore ladies won 2x Firsts, Homebred Champion & Reserve and Reserve Longhorn breed Champion 👍🏆

Silage fever has commenced in the Derbyshire Dales.
First cut is done ✔️ which is a massive relief. Our contractors next task is reseeding.

My show team decided to escape the garden and go for a tour of the village. Luckily they stood in the empty silage fields looking very perplexed and waited for me to walk them home!

Calving is almost complete but our outlier Hobnob finally had 2 lovely bull calf twins.
One was quite knuckled so after a couple of days he was getting left behind, so we made the executive decision to bring him home and hand rear him... well, Monty is!

We now only have 1 cull cow left to go!

May so far... 🪻

It's been a busy few weeks on the farm!

We've really ramped up show training, we aim to walk and wash the team once a day for 3 weeks before the first show.

We've brought both Longhorn and Blonde bulls home to ensure a tight calving block.

Poor Weasel had an injury to his foot, so needed bringing home sooner than I'd like. He served Xenolith on the way in, so luckily he's now covered all my cows!

His foot is on the mend, massive thanks to our wonderful trimmer, who also did Titan's feet plus the show team.

Otherwise we've been installing permanent wooden fencing with electric on mains... as our neighbours know, we struggled to keep the cows in last Summer!

Plus our team of wallers have been cracking on with our dilapidated limestone dry stone walls.

We've been grazing the cows tightly to make use of what grass we have!

Our draught sale at Bakewell went well and we're happy to hear all have settled in well in their new homes.

Calving is finished for the Longhorns (and accidental Blonghorn calves) and almost complete for the Blondes.

We haven't had to touch a cow since they've gone out, we drive round and find fresh dropped calves up and about! 👌
